HB 1437 Electric utility restructuring; changes in provisions.

Introduced by: Harvey B. Morgan | all patrons    ...    notes | add to my profiles

SUMMARY AS INTRODUCED:

Electric Utility Restructuring Act. Suspends indefinitely, except for pilot programs, competition among suppliers of electric energy to retail customers in the Commonwealth; facilitates the proceedings of the Commission on Electric Utility Restructuring with regard to monitoring the development of competitive wholesale electric markets and making future judgments as to the viability of retail customer choice in the Commonwealth; returns incumbent electric utilities to the rate making jurisdiction of the State Corporation Commission on a cost-of-service basis pursuant to Chapter 10 of Title 56; and authorizes, except as otherwise provided, the State Corporation Commission to continue to regulate the generation, transmission, and distribution of retail electric energy in the Commonwealth. The bill does not disturb requirements related to the transfer of management and control of transmission assets to regional transmission entities, including the Commission's responsibilities concerning such transfers, nor does it inhibit retail competition involving pilot programs.
